What sound does waterfall make?

burble Add to list Share. To burble is to move with a rippling flow the way water bubbles down the side of a small garden waterfall. A stream burbles as it travels along its bed bubbling over rocks and branches. The verb burble captures both the movement of the water and the sound it makes as it moves.

What is the description of waterfall?

A waterfall is a river or other body of water’s steep fall over a rocky ledge into a plunge pool below. … Often waterfalls form as streams flow from soft rock to hard rock. This happens both laterally (as a stream flows across the earth) and vertically (as the stream drops in a waterfall).

Is white noise real?

White noise probably the most familiar of these sounds like a radio tuned to an unused frequency. Similar to the way white light contains all the wavelengths of the visible spectrum at equal intensity white noise has equal power across all frequencies audible to the human ear.

What is blue noise?

Blue noise which is sometimes considered high-frequency white noise is a noise color with a spectral density (power per hertz) that is proportional to its frequency. … Also known as azure noise blue noise gets its name from optics as the color blue is on the higher end of the frequency spectrum for visible light.

Why is it called brown noise?

However brown noise doesn’t get its moniker from the color — it’s actually named after botanist Robert Brown who discovered Brownian motion (random particle motion) in the 1800s. Brown noise is also known as Brownian noise because its change in sound signal from one moment to the next is random.
